Intern at MSNBC TV

Accepted Offer – Reviewed Feb 28, 2013

Interview Details – Pretty basic process. Had a phone interview that lasted approx. 30 min, didn't ask anything too difficult. I kept in touch with the interviewer (producer) via email over the next week or two, and ultimately got the job. I was out of state, so I never had an in-person interview.

Interview Question – Why Morning Joe? Tell me about your background?   Answer Question
